Transaction 423562cd5f9a222499855607c863e78ef6099859fc42a3dae0856d303990d087
1 Input
1 Output
-
423562cd5f9a222499855607c863e78ef6099859fc42a3dae0856d303990d087:0
- value
- 2383333
- script pubkey
- OP_0 OP_PUSHBYTES_20 e87c6fe7073d385bc8f626ad21a314fd3fd64a48
- address
- ltc1qap7xlec885u9hj8ky6kjrgc5l5lavjjgshw3n4